I am not able to get Outlook XP to sync with my exchange acct on a
satellite connection.

IMAP to the same server (same acct) works fine, but not MAPI.  That is
the only way I can sync my contacts.

The company hosting my exchange server says that MAPI doesn't work
over satellite connections due to the large latency involved.

Is it really true that out can't run MAPI over a Starband or DirectPC
connection?

Is a way to tell Outlook XP to use longer timeouts?
